Escalation of Clashes

In recent weeks, Yemen has witnessed a significant escalation in violence as Houthi rebels, supported by Iran, have intensified their military operations against the internationally recognized Yemeni government. Reports indicate that these clashes have resulted in substantial casualties on both sides, raising alarms over the humanitarian crisis in the region.

Impact on Civilians

The intensification of conflict directly impacts civilians, with thousands displaced from their homes and an urgent need for humanitarian assistance. The ongoing hostilities disrupt essential services, making it increasingly difficult for aid organizations to deliver relief to those in need.

Regional Repercussions

As tensions rise in Yemen, the implications extend beyond its borders. Neighboring countries, particularly in the Gulf region, are closely monitoring the situation, as the conflict could potentially spill over into broader regional instability.

The Role of Iran

Iran's support for the Houthi rebels is a critical factor in this ongoing conflict. By providing military and logistical aid, Iran not only bolsters the Houthis' capabilities but also exacerbates tensions with Saudi Arabia and other Gulf states. This geopolitical dynamic complicates efforts toward peace and resolution.
